Naracho
Naracho is a neighborhood in Kita-ku, Saitama, Saitama. Naracho is situated nearby to the quarter 戸崎, as well as near the neighborhood Miyaharacho 4-chome.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Miyahara Station
Railway station
Photo: Mister0124,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Miyahara Station is a passenger railway station located in Kita-ku, the city of Saitama, Saitama Prefecture, Japan, operated by the East Japan Railway Company.

Nishi
Suburb
Photo: Ebiebi2,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Nishi-ku is one of ten wards of Saitama, in Saitama Prefecture, Japan, and is located in the far western part of the city. As of 1 March 2021, the ward had an estimated population of 93,527 and a population density of 3200 persons per km². Nishi is situated 3 km southwest of Naracho.
